7 Day Natural Face Mask Recipes for Glowing Skin
Easy DIY skincare using ingredients you already have at home!
Looking for a simple, natural, and affordable skincare routine? These 7 day natural face mask recipes are perfect for those who want to try different treatments each day without getting bored. Each recipe uses common ingredients you can easily find in your kitchen or local store.
Use 2–3 times a week, or choose the mask that fits your skin’s needs best.
Day 1 – Honey & Lemon Brightening Mask
Benefits: Brightening & Antibacterial
Ingredients:
1 tbsp pure honey
½ tsp lemon juice
Instructions:
Mix well, apply evenly on your face, leave for 10–15 minutes, then rinse with warm water.
This natural face mask helps brighten dull skin and fights acne-causing bacteria.
Day 2 – Cucumber & Aloe Vera Cooling Mask
Benefits: Refreshing & Hydrating
Ingredients:
3 thin slices of cucumber (or blended)
1 tbsp aloe vera gel
Instructions:
Apply a thin layer on your face, leave for 15 minutes, then rinse with cool water.
Perfect for soothing sun-exposed or tired skin.
Day 3 – Oatmeal & Milk Softening Mask
Benefits: Smoothing & Gentle Exfoliation
Ingredients:
2 tbsp finely ground oatmeal
2 tbsp milk (or warm water)
Instructions:
Mix into a paste, apply for 15 minutes, gently massage, then rinse.
This DIY mask removes dead skin cells and leaves skin silky smooth.
Day 4 – Turmeric & Yogurt Glow Mask
Benefits: Anti-acne & Brightening
Ingredients:
½ tsp turmeric powder
2 tbsp plain yogurt
Instructions:
Mix, apply evenly, leave for 10 minutes, then rinse.
Turmeric’s natural anti-inflammatory properties help calm breakouts and give your skin a radiant glow.
Day 5 – Green Tea & Honey Antioxidant Mask
Benefits: Calming & Anti-aging
Ingredients:
1 green tea bag (brewed, use the leaves)
1 tbsp honey
Instructions:
Mix and spread evenly on your face, leave for 15 minutes, then rinse.
Packed with antioxidants, this mask protects skin from free radicals and soothes irritation.
Day 6 – Banana & Honey Moisturizing Mask
Benefits: Deep Hydration & Anti-aging
Ingredients:
½ ripe banana (mashed)
1 tbsp honey
Instructions:
Apply evenly, leave for 15 minutes, rinse with warm water.
Banana provides vitamins and moisture, while honey locks it in — perfect for dry skin.
Day 7 – Avocado & Olive Oil Nourishing Mask
Benefits: Extra Nutrition & Hydration
Ingredients:
2 tbsp mashed ripe avocado
1 tsp olive oil
Instructions:
Spread evenly on your face, leave for 15 minutes, then rinse.
This is the ultimate hydration booster for glowing, supple skin.
Important Tips Before You Start
Always patch test first on your hand to check for allergies.
Use masks 2–3 times a week max to avoid over-exfoliation.
After rinsing off the mask, gently pat dry with a soft towel and follow with your favorite moisturizer.
